Documentation of package lin_algebra

This is the documentation of a package named lin-algebra. This package includes a function which can help with many linear algebra problems.

lin-algebra.Matrix

Constructor

Take a two-dimensional list as a parameter and make a Matrix object.

Operators overloaded

  • (+) add two matrices and return a Matrix object with added elements.
  • (-) subtract two matrices and return a Matrix object with subtracted elements.
  • (* num) (type float or int) multiply all elements of Matrix by the number.
  • (* Matrix) make matrix multiplication and return the Matrix object of it.
  • (+=) add each element of the called Matrix to the corresponding element.
  • (-=) subtract each element of the called Matrix by corresponding element.
  • (*= num) (type float or int) multiply all elements of the called Matrix by the number.
  • (*= Matrix) make matrix multiplication and change called Matrix to the result of it.
  • (==) return true if all elements are the same.
  • (!=) return true if it is the difference between two matrices.

Operations on matrices

  • det() return determinant of the squared matrix.
  • is_squared() return true if the matrix is squared and false if it is not.
  • T() return a Matrix objets which is the transpose of the called matrix.
  • inv() return a Matrix object which is inverse of the called matrix.

Operations on the diagonal and antidiagonal

  • is_diagonal() return if the called matrix is diagonal.
  • get_main_diagonal() return list includes elements of main diagonal.
  • is_identity() return if the called matrix is identity.
  • is_antidiagonal() return if the called matrix is anti-diagonal.
  • get_antidiagonal() return list includes elements of antidiagonal.
  • is_exchange() return if the called matrix is exchanged.
  • trace() return trace of diagonal matrix.

Other functions

  • size() return tuple with number of rows and columns.
  • print() print matrix.
  • gen_zero(rows, columns) return Matrix objects with size specified by rows and columns.
  • gen_random(rows, columns) return Matrix objects with size specified by rows and columns.

lin-algebra.Vector

Constructor

Take as parameter one-dimensional list and create Vector object

Overloaded operators

  • (+) add two vectors and return a Vector object with added elements.
  • (-) subtract two vectors and return a Vector object with subtracted elements.
  • (* num) (type float or int) multiply all elements of Vector by the number.
  • (* Vector) make a dot product and return the result of it.
  • (+=) add to each element of the called Vector the corresponding element.
  • (-=) subtract each element of the called Vector by corresponding element.
  • (*= num) (type float or int) multiply all elements of the called Vector by the number.
  • (*= Vector) make a dot product and change the called Vector to the result of it.
  • (==) return true if all elements are the same.
  • (!=) return true if it is the difference between two vectors.

Operations on vectors

  • vector_scalar_product(scalar) multiply each element by scalar and return the new vector
  • dot(V1) return dot product of vectors
  • cross(V1) return tuple includes Vector object with elements created by cross product and length of the result vector

Other functions

  • size() return the size of the Vector.
  • length() return the length of the Vector.
  • print() prints vector.
  • gen_zero(dimensions) return Vector object of zero vector
  • gen_random(dimensions) return Vector object with random values from 0 to 30
